Dr Gianmarco Regazzola is an orthopedic surgeon specialized in hip and knee surgery and trauma management. When treating patients, he combines his international training background and profound knowledge in the most advanced technologies in the field of robotics with a personalized and transparent approach, which focuses on the needs of the individual to better define the curative path based on recent medical studies.
Dr Regazzola’s professional passion is centered on prosthetic surgery of the hip and knee and revision surgery, robotic surgery and prosthetic surgery with computerized navigation, as well as reconstructive surgery of the knee.
In 2009 he graduated with a Medical Degree at the University of Insubria in Varese and from the same university in 2015, he was awarded his Specialisation Diploma in Orthopaedics and Traumatology. In addition to his academic training in Italy, he also undertook hip and knee subspecialty training in Australia, one of the most advanced countries in the field of robotic surgery.
Between 2014 and 2017, he completed two prestigious clinical and research fellowships accredited by the Australian Orthopaedic Association (AOA). During this period, he served as a fellow at the Hip and Knee Clinic at Sydney Olympic Park under the guidance of Prof. Warwick Bruce, Dr. Peter Walker and Prof. William Walsh, and was exposed to the most advanced techniques in the treatment of hip and knee problems. Later, he trained alongside Dr. Myles Coolican, Dr. David Parker and Dr. Brett Fritsch at the Sydney Orthopedic Research Institute, an organization dedicated to the study and research of orthopedic disorders, especially those related to knee joints.
He made numerous research contributions on topics such as prosthetic osteointegration, biomechanics, and knee kinematics, in collaboration with the Sydney Orthopedic Research Institute (SORI) and the Surgical Orthopedic Research Laboratory (SORL), a research laboratory where surgery, engineering and medicine competencies are merged. Among his scientific publications, Dr Regazzola has produced several articles and has authored an entire chapter dedicated to hip and knee prosthetic surgery, knee reconstructive surgery and osteointegration in the book “Soft Tissue Balancing in Total Knee Arthoplasty (2017 , Springer Berlin, Heildelberg). Dr. Regazzola also has presented his studies at prestigious national and international congresses.
Today, besides seeing patients from his private studio next to Piazza Arnaldo in Brescia, Dr. Regazzola also serves at the Poliambulanza Institute of Brescia, Italy, an innovation center for healthcare, research and training, internationally accredited by the Joint Commission International (JCI), the organization that certifies the quality of hospitals worldwide. The Institute Poliambulanza’s orthopedic team led by Dr. Flavio Terragnoli uses cutting-edge technologies such as Fast Track Protocol for hip and knee prostheses.
